Other Wrestling

  • Impact announced that Against All Odds will take place on June 10 in Columbus, Ohio.
  • Former WWE star Eva Marie has signed a new fitness deal with TYR Sport.
  • Sam Adonis has replaced real1 (Enzo Amore) in the upcoming MLW War Chamber match.
  • On a recent episode of The Wise Men, Kevin Kiley Jr. (Alex Riley) said his recent eye surgery was a success.
